It looks like damage from a Coin Wrapping Machine. This coin could have been the end coin in the roll and the crimping jaws on the machine made contact with the coin as it rotated.

I was thinking that. But if it did why did it skip over and then in and out of lettering and Date ? Instead of going through them?

The devices in this area are incuse, so they are below the surrounding surface. The scratch is on the highest area, with the letters and digits too deep for the scratch to have damaged. If this had been regular relief devices, the scratch would (most likely) have been just on the tops of the letters and digits.
